As Generative AI Disrupts Music, Artists Elevate Co-Creation

Nov 30, 2023 - forbes.com
Award-winning singer and songwriter Grimes is collaborating with Los Angeles-based CreateSafe to build Triniti API, a generative AI music production platform that artists can use to create and distribute music. The platform allows rights-holders of music IP to license their assets for pay when their data is used in Triniti's models. Artists can also distribute their work using DSPs like Spotify, Apple, and Tidal. Grimes has also partnered with Australian DJ and producer Kito, who used Grimes' tech startup Elf.tech to create a song featuring Grimes' voice.

CreateSafe has partnered with Slip.stream, a music technology platform that provides a licensing platform for its users to download and safely use tracks and sound effects from leading labels and artists. The partnership allows Slip.stream creators to choose from more than 200 GrimesAI tracks and use the beats in their content. Slip.stream has also launched a suite of AI tools to enhance creativity, including an AI-powered Video Soundtrack Genie and an Audio Content Genie.
